Index funds invests in stocks that emulate a market index like NSE Nifty, BSE Sensex, etc. They invest in the same securities which are present in underlying index. These funds aim to offer returns comparable to the index they track.
Gains are treated as short-term capital gains and taxed at 15%
Gains of over ₹ 1 lakh in a financial year are taxed at 10%

Reliance Nippon Life Asset Management or RNAM is one of India’s two largest asset management companies. Currently, it has over $60 billion in its corpus. It is a wholly owned subsidiary of the Reliance Anil Dhirubhai Ambani or ADA Group.
